Tasting notes
Color
Pale yellow with greenish glints, bright and elegant.
Aroma
Delicate aromas combining white fruit such as peach, white flowers, and citrus or tropical notes like pineapple and lemon.
Palate
Sweet and smooth entry, followed by a fresh acidity that balances the sweetness. Fruity notes such as peach, apple, and citrus. The finish is clean and round.

Harvest
A careful hand-harvest is carried out in 400kg bins, within the first and second half of February.
Winemaking
Selection, destemming, and pneumatic pressing, pH correction with tartaric acid, and pre-fermentation. Selected yeasts are added to initiate the co-fermentation of both varietals at a temperature of 12-15 °C, for a period of 12 to 15 days. Fermentation is interrupted with chilling and tangential filtration to achieve the desired sugar levels per liter.
